Page 2: Global Pulses Conclave 2012

Meeting Future Food Needs

• World population growth may slow from 1% to 0.5% by 2050

• Average net field crop output needs to rise at least 1% per year through 2050

• Ethanol from grain may be unsustainable

Page 6: Global Pulses Conclave 2012

Global Crop Production Outlook

• Pulses are a minor crop the world’s perspective

• Canada’s pulse breeders think they can add an average 1% per year to yield with new varieties

• Pulses do not get same attention from plant breeders as rice, soybeans, or corn

• Long term yield gains may be smaller than 1%

Page 14: Global Pulses Conclave 2012

Field Pea 2012 Outlook

• Canadian acreage will be up because of good movement and strong prices

• U.S. acreage will rise as farmers bring flooded land back into production

• France’s acreage will fall because the feed pea subsidy has been removed

• Prices should be lower on average

Page 17: Global Pulses Conclave 2012

Canada Pea Supply-Demand(metric tons)

5-year average 2011-12 2012-13

Production 2,923,000 2,115,600 2,786,000

Carry In 444,000 535,000 210,000

Stocks 3,399,000 2,669,200 3,014,800

Exports 2,389,000 2,115,000 2,296,000

All Domestic 709,000 344,200 514,800

Ending Stocks 301,000 200,000 250,000

Stocks to Use 9.7 % 8.1 % 9.1 %

FOB Price $294 $390 $275 - $350

Page 19: Global Pulses Conclave 2012

Lentil 2012 Outlook

• Canadian acreage will drop because of poor prices

• U.S. acreage will rise as farmers bring flooded land back into production

• Prices should be lower on average for green lentils but unchanged to firmer for red

Page 22: Global Pulses Conclave 2012

Canada Lentil Supply-Demand(metric tons)

5-year average 2011-12 2012-13

Production 1,182,000 1,531,900 1,174,000

Carry In 176,000 750,000 560,000

Stocks 1,366,000 2,295,200 1,741,000

Exports 967,000 1,191,000 1,228,000

All Domestic 167,000 445,200 222,000

Ending Stocks 232,000 560,000 320,000

Stocks to Use 20.5 % 32.3 % 22.5 %

Laird FOB Price $816 $890 $675 - $850

Red FOB Price $763 $639 $625 - $700

Page 33: Global Pulses Conclave 2012

Battle For Acres

• Farmers will not grow pulses unless they can make as much or more money than growing other crops

• Consumers will not buy more pulses unless they are as cheap or cheaper than other foods

• As a result, all crops follow same price pattern
